2 stars not 1 because food was acceptable and quick. However, price is NOT right, ESPECIALLY given competition. Regular platter $14 when it can be found at higher quality with MORE and BETTER food for $9-10 at any local food truck. Pita limp, all-beef gyro meat as opposed to lamb/beef mix. "Specialty" ocean tea was $5.50, a bad deal at any size, and the fact it was smaller than a small soda was laughable. Phyllo in the Baklava Cheesecake was stale, or at least limp, but I expected that tbf. Paying over $28 for that felt awful. Meat is flavorful and the family meal is a good deal for the money and comes with fresh veggies and pita. It's about $60 and my family of 5 gets 2 meals out of it (so 10 servings.) Granted 2 of our family members are very light eaters, but still.
The only thing I don't love is the rice. It doesn't have much flavor unless you add sauce. And the hot sauce is WAY too hot. Other than that, great food. Best wings I've ever tried. All the proteins are fantastic.
